Lasso CRM

Lasso CRM helps you manage the entire lifecycle of a new home sale, from the moment a lead registers on your website to the day they move in. Unlike general-purpose CRMs, this platform is built specifically for the real estate industry, meaning you get pre-configured workflows for high-volume sales environments. You can capture leads automatically from your website, third-party listing sites, and onsite kiosks to ensure no prospect falls through the cracks.

The software enables you to automate your follow-up processes with personalized email templates and scheduled touchpoints. You can also track inventory, manage contracts, and generate detailed sales reports to see exactly which marketing sources are driving your revenue. It simplifies the complex process of selling new construction by keeping your entire sales team synchronized on a single, industry-specific platform.

nCino

nCino transforms how you manage your financial institution by moving traditional, siloed banking processes into a single cloud-based platform. Built on Salesforce, it allows you to handle everything from initial customer onboarding and loan origination to portfolio management and account opening without switching between disconnected systems. You can digitize complex workflows, automate manual data entry, and gain a clear view of your entire relationship with every client.

The platform is designed specifically for banks and credit unions of all sizes, helping you close loans faster and reduce operational risks. By centralizing your data, you can ensure compliance with evolving regulations while providing a modern, digital experience for your customers. It eliminates the friction of paper-based processes, allowing your team to focus on building stronger client relationships and growing your portfolio efficiently.

Lasso CRM Features

  • Lead Management Capture leads automatically from your website and listing services so you can respond to every inquiry instantly.
  • Sales Automation Set up automated email workflows and follow-up reminders to keep your prospects engaged throughout their long buying journey.
  • Inventory Tracking Monitor the status of every lot and floorplan in real-time to provide accurate availability to your potential buyers.
  • Email Marketing Create and send professional mass emails to your entire database with built-in templates designed for real estate promotions.
  • Reporting & Analytics Run detailed reports on traffic, sales velocity, and marketing ROI to make data-driven decisions for your communities.
  • Mobile Access Access your prospect data and update lead status from the sales center or the field using any mobile device.

nCino Features

  • Commercial Banking. Streamline complex commercial loan originations with automated workflows that move deals from application to funding faster.
  • Retail Banking. Open new accounts and process consumer loans instantly across digital channels or in-branch with a simplified interface.
  • Mortgage Lending. Manage the end-to-end mortgage process on a single platform to improve transparency and reduce closing times for borrowers.
  • Customer Engagement. View a complete 360-degree profile of your customers so you can provide personalized service and identify cross-selling opportunities.
  • Portfolio Analytics. Monitor your entire loan portfolio in real-time to identify risks, track performance, and make data-driven lending decisions.
  • Compliance & Risk. Ensure every transaction meets regulatory standards with built-in audit trails and automated policy checks throughout the workflow.
